Core: The Anatomy of a Data Gap

The typical crypto asset has at least four layers of data dependency: on-chain transactions, off-chain feeds, aggregated metrics from platforms like CoinGecko, and derived indicators like funding rates. Each layer introduces a potential gap. The gap is not a glitch. It is a structural feature of an immature market where data aggregators prioritize speed over accuracy.

Consider the case of a Layer2 token that claimed 500,000 daily active users. The number came from the official block explorer. But my analysis of the mempool showed that 80% of those transactions were from a single relay contract performing automated cross-chain swaps. The user count was inflated by a factor of five. The market priced the token based on the inflated number. When the real number leaked, the token dropped 25% in four hours. The gap was not a lie. It was an omission. The data was technically correct. But it was contextually meaningless.

This is the core insight: the market does not price risk. It prices the data that is available. When the data is incomplete, the market is mispriced. The gap becomes the invisible variable that traders ignore until it closes. And when it closes, the move is violent.

Contrarian: The Decoupling Thesis Is a Data Illusion

There is a popular narrative that crypto is decoupling from traditional markets. The argument: Bitcoin is a macro hedge, gold 2.0, independent of Fed policy. I have heard this thesis since 2017. Every time, it has been proven wrong. The reason is not macro. It is data.

The decoupling thesis relies on a single data point: the correlation coefficient between Bitcoin and the S&P 500. During certain periods, the coefficient drops to zero or negative. Traders declare independence. But the coefficient is a lagging indicator. It measures past relationships. It does not measure the underlying liquidity flows.

I track a different data set: the offshore dollar funding premium. When the premium spikes, crypto liquidity dries up within 48 hours. The correlation is not visible in the daily price charts. But it is visible in the on-chain stablecoin flows. The data gap is the lag. Traders see the price move. They do not see the liquidity crunch that preceded it. The decoupling is not a decoupling. It is a data delay.
